“50 years of a country full of joy” - An epic song from the heart of Hanoi

The political and artistic program “50 years of the country full of joy”, organized by Hanoi Radio and Television, will take place at 8:00 p.m. on April 30 at Doan Mon Stadium, Thang Long Imperial Citadel relic site (19C Hoang Dieu, Ba Dinh, Hanoi), broadcast live on channels H1, HTV, FM96 and the Hanoi On application.

“50 years of the country full of joy” was held to celebrate the 50th anniversary of the Liberation of the South and National Reunification Day (April 30, 1975 - April 30, 2025). The program recreated the atmosphere of this day half a century ago, when troops "rushed like a flood" towards Saigon; at the same time, once again affirming the key role, both as the brain and the pioneer of the Capital in the great march of the nation.

In the program, the audience will enjoy songs associated with important historical milestones such as “Cau ho ben bo Hien Luong” (poem by Dang Giang, music by Hoang Hiep), “Xa khoi” (Nguyen Tai Tue), “Bai ca hy vong” (Van Ky)… or songs expressing the spirit of “looking to the South” such as “Chiec cay Truong Son” (Pham Tuyen), “Tinh ca” (Hoang Viet)… The songs “Ha Noi, Hue , Saigon” (Hoang Van), “Hue, Saigon, Ha Noi” (Trinh Cong Son) in the program affirm the connection of three places during the resistance war.

In particular, the art night brings to the audience compositions about the capital during the most difficult days of the war, such as "Hanoi, sleepless nights" (Pham Tuyen), "Hanoi song" (Vu Thanh)... The songs "Hurried letter" (Duong Cam), "My memories" (Phu Quang)... will partly recreate the feelings and thoughts of the young soldiers of Hanoi "putting down their pens and going to battle", to have the moment when the whole country and people sing together the melody of "Song of unification" (Vo Van Di), "The country is full of joy" (Hoang Ha)...

The bustling atmosphere of the Capital's patriotic emulation movements such as "Three ready", "Three brave", "Three best flags", "Great wind"... is also recreated in the program "50 years of a country full of joy" through vivid reports, images and documents.

The program included a tribute to announcer Trinh Thi Ngo of the “Hanoi Hannah” group, consisting of Vietnamese female announcers who, during the resistance war, took turns reading propaganda announcements on the Voice of Vietnam (Radio Hanoi) to call on American soldiers to abandon the war and demand the right to return home. A special report on the “Steel Helmet” Regiment took the audience back to the top of Chu Tan Kra (Sa Thay district, Kon Tum province), where, in the early morning of March 26, 1968, more than 200 soldiers of the 209th Regiment - 312th Division heroically sacrificed their lives in a fierce confrontation with American soldiers.

Here, the audience also interacted with historical witnesses who were soldiers, young intellectuals who left Hanoi lecture halls, put on their backpacks and went to the battlefield, and witnesses present at Saigon Radio Station on April 30, 1975...

The program “50 years of the country full of joy” was elaborately staged, harmoniously combining political and artistic language, with the participation of many beloved artists such as People's Artist Tan Minh, Meritorious Artist Lan Anh; singers My Linh, Quach Mai Thy, Tran Tung Anh, Kyo York; Thang Long group, Hanoi Radio Symphony Orchestra, Tre Dance Group...
